spring cloud alibaba学习(一)–DubboDubbo spring cloud 是基于 阿里开源的 dubbo 技术栈,按照spring cloud 规范实现的一套微服务治理技术框架,和 spring cloud (基于 netfix 开源的一些技术栈)类似功能spring cloudspring cloud alibaba分布式配置(Distributed configura
转载
2024-03-26 23:57:32
81阅读
一、为什么要用dubbo服务治理框架服务的监控服务的注册发现服务的通信服务的容错服务的负载均衡SpringCloud Alibaba :DubboseatarocketMQNacosSentinel二、Dubbo Spring Cloud的demo2.1创建一个项目创建一个spring-cloud-dubbo-example的maven工程分别添加三个模块:spring-cloud-dubbo-s
转载
2024-05-15 12:01:01
344阅读
目录什么是OpenFeign未使用OpenFeign使用了OpenFeignOpenFeign基础使用一、pom依赖二、yml配置文件三、启动类添加注解四、Service层五、Controller层控制超时时间日志打印具体使用Sentinel整合OpenFeignpom依赖yml配置Service接口Service实习类——处理Feign调用的异常控制器类和@SentinelResource的对
转载
2024-09-10 11:17:42
66阅读
通过优锐课核心java学习笔记中,我们可以看到,码了很多专业的相关知识, 分享给大家参考学习。看一下如何在阿里巴巴的Spring Cloud实现中使用这个流行的RPC框架。Spring Cloud AlibabaSpring Cloud Alibaba是Alibaba Cloud的Spring Cloud版本。 它由几个阿里巴巴的开源项目Nacos,Sentinel和RocketMQ以及几个阿里云
转载
2024-05-28 10:20:33
66阅读
1.概述在之前 《什么是 Spring Cloud Alibaba》一文中我们有介绍过Dubbo,除了SpringCloud以外,Dubbo它也是用来作为微服务架构落地的成熟解决方案,并且它在服务通信上比SpringCloud性能更高,这取决于它的底层实现是基于原生的TCP协议,它的定位就是一款高性能的RPC(远程过程调用)框架,所以在国内很多的企业都选择Dubbo作为微服务框架,本文章的目的是帮
转载
2024-03-21 10:05:17
151阅读
目录一、Spring Cloud Alibaba依赖说明二、代码示例1、父工程spring-cloud-alibaba-learning版本依赖信息2、子工程spring-cloud-alibaba-seata-consumer服务消费者(1) 版本依赖(2) application.yml配置(3) Dubbo服务引用(4) 启动类3、子工程spring-cloud-alibaba-seata
转载
2024-04-11 12:29:55
198阅读
1. 概述本文我们来学习 Spring Cloud Alibaba 提供的 Spring Cloud Alibaba Dubbo 组件,接入 Dubbo 实现服务调用。Dubbo Spring Cloud 基于 Dubbo Spring Boot 2.7.1 和 Spring Cloud 2.x 开发,无论开发人员是 Dubbo 用户还是
转载
2024-03-18 20:40:14
39阅读
Spring Cloud Alibaba + Dubbo 在微服务世界里,服务间的调用就像小伙伴之间传纸条。你可以直接跑过去,也可以用 Dubbo——微服务界的“极速传声筒”,帮你瞬间把消息传到对方手里,还保证安全可靠。 本文将从 Dubbo 的原理、配置、使用场景到实战经验进行全面解析,让你看懂又 ...
Spring Cloud集成Dubbo目前Dubbo在国内还是有较多公司在使用的,一方面是因为Dubbo作为阿里巴巴开源的一个SOA服务治理解决方案,在国内发展较早,有比较好的先发优势;另一方面是因为在国内很多工程师对Dubbo框架都比较熟悉,有比较完善的文档介绍和实例;还有,Dubbo框架的性能优势和基于SPI的扩展机制也是Dubbo的优势所在。然而,现在很多人也拿Dubbo与Spring Cl
转载
2024-04-01 06:08:51
135阅读
Spring Boot是一个快速开发的脚手架,用来快速创建独立的、生产级的基于spring的应用程序。
--特性
无需部署war文件
提供starter简化配置
尽可能自动配置Spring以及第三方库
提供“生产就绪”功能,例如指标、健康检查、外部配置等
无代码生成&无XML
--应用组成
依赖:pom.xml
启动类:注解
配置:application.properties
stati
转载
2024-04-05 09:09:34
30阅读
前言上次学习了SpringCloudAlibaba的注册中心+配置中心Nacos,写了一个小Demo,对SpringCloudAlibaba有了一个基本的认知。这次将引入Dubbo,实现服务间的调用。在接触SpringCloudAlibaba之前,微服务之间的调用,我们最常用的可能是Feign。在上次的Demo中,用的则是LoadBalance的方式。这一次,将试着用Dubbo来实现微服务之间的调
转载
2023-12-12 14:39:19
61阅读
SpringCloud1. 什么是 SpringCloudSpring Cloud是快速构建微服务项目的Java框架,为解决微服务架构的各种问题提供了一整套方案和实现。Spring Cloud为微服务架构开发涉及的配置管理,服务治理,熔断机制,智能路由,微代理,控制总线,一次性token,全局一致性锁,leader选举,分布式session,集群状态管理等操作提供了一种简单的开发方式。在微服务架构
文章目录SpringCloud Alibaba Seata处理分布式事务1、分布式事务问题2、Seata-Server安装3、订单/库存/账户业务数据库准备4、订单/库存/账户业务微服务准备5、Seata之原理简介再次回顾 SpringCloud Alibaba Seata处理分布式事务1、分布式事务问题分布式前单机单库没这个问题从1:1 -> 1:N -> N: N分布式之后一句话
Spring Cloud Alibaba Dubbo为什么?是什么?怎么做?为什么?单体应用 单体服务经过长期的迭代更新,逐渐走向代码臃肿、高耦合,这显然与我们软件开发设计理念高内聚\低耦合背道而驰,从而难以维护~ 市场需求也在逐渐要求服务高并发、高性能、高可用,在这样的场景下,单体服务宕机重启时间长、访问过慢的问题一一暴露!分布式应用系统 分布式开发,将服务拆分,是建立在网络之上的软件系统。正是
转载
2024-03-22 10:36:06
58阅读
技术杂谈Springcloud alibab和dubbo有什么区别?最明显的区别,他们的定位不一样SpringCloud Alibaba首先说一下SpringCloudAlibaba(以下称 SCA),他的定位是微服务架构的一站式解决方案,特点就是 齐全 ,也就是它的生态非常齐全,对于熔断、服务监控、网关、服务跟踪、服务调用都有对应的组件,比如 Hystrix 熔断器,Gateway 网关,Eur
目录一、为什么会出现SpringCloud alibaba1、Spring Cloud Netflix项目进入维护模式二、SpringCloud alibaba带来了什么?1、官网2、作用3、下载4、怎么玩三、SpringCloud alibaba学习资料获取1、官网2、英文3、中文 一、为什么会出现SpringCloud alibaba1、Spring Cloud Netflix项目进入维护模
转载
2024-05-10 11:20:53
46阅读
Spring Cloud Alibaba 致力于提供微服务开发的一站式解决方案。此项目包含开发分布式应用微服务的必需组件,方便开发者通过 Spring Cloud 编程模型轻松使用这些组件来开发分布式应用服务。依托 Spring Cloud Alibaba,您只需要添加一些注解和少量配置,就可以将 Spring Cloud 应用接入阿里微服务解决方案,通过阿里中间件来迅速搭建分布式应用系统。此外,
转载
2024-07-02 12:19:33
99阅读
SpringCloud-Alibaba之Dubbo概述可能说起来Dubbo,很多人都不陌生,这毕竟是一款从2012年就开始开源的Java RPC框架,中间由于各种各样的原因停止更新4年半的时间,中间只发过一个小版本修了一个小bug,甚至大家都以为这个项目已经死掉了,竟然又在2017年9月份恢复了更新,不可谓不神奇。网络上很多人都拿Dubbo和Spring Cloud做对比,可能在大家的心目中,这两
转载
2024-02-19 13:31:48
72阅读
Spring Cloud之acos服务与Dubbonacos是springcloud的扩展,中心功能通过NacosDiscoveryClient 继承DiscoveryClient,在springcloud中,与Eureka可以无侵入的切换。中心可以手动剔除服务实例,通过消息通知客户端缓存的实例信息。Dubbo是一个分布式服务框架,Doubbo的产生让我们告别了+restf
转载
2024-06-21 20:05:51
366阅读
微服务这个概念在行业上出现许久时间了,其它我在工作前几年就一直都在用微服务的模式开发了,那时用的还是Dubbo+springmvc+hession,后面Spring Source后出了分布式的解决方案SpringCloud
原创
2022-01-11 17:55:54
320阅读